See hashtag #NationalPhilanthropyDay National Philanthropy Day in the United States dates back to the 1980s when it was conceived by Douglas Freeman, a professional fundraiser. The Association of Fundraising Professionals (AFP) played a significant role in promoting and organizing National Philanthropy Day activities. In the U.S.,
